Output 6666b90cc33bc621bb7d5801af40e230bc8335609543914678999b5758559d22:0

value
966624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82a150aa67e1131b5a53654e29f6e17c778bf906 OP_EQUAL
address
3Dbj1rLFDtYLJwyY5Dyv1e1D6MWYKJGdZ3
transaction
6666b90cc33bc621bb7d5801af40e230bc8335609543914678999b5758559d22
spent
true